Will CEUs be offered?
YES! IAABC has issued 13 CEUs. CCPDT has issued 13 CBCC-KA CEUs. Please note, courses approved for CBCC-KA CEUs may be applied to a CPDT-KA or CPDT-KSA recertification.
How will CEUs and Certificates of Attendance be awarded?
In order to receive CEUs OR a certificate of attendance, you must provide a code for each lecture, this code will be given out randomly during each presentation. You will need to note the codes for all the presentations before submitting them online. All attendees have a deadline to complete the CEU quiz. No CEUs or Certificates of Attendance will be awarded until all questions are completed.
